Change factors are numerous in the Packaging sector and drive innovation:
● Increasingly strict regulations, e.g. food contact, chemical products, traceability...
● Environment friendliness: lighter, biodegradable, recyclable materials
● New technologies: printing techniques, design softwares, new materials including nanotechnologies, smart Packaging with RFID or DataMatrix code
● Population trends: increased ergonomic requirements for older people,single-serve Packaging for individual consumption.
As far as machinery is concerned, the trend is towards a market segmentation between high-performance machines for long-run production requiring qualified high-cost labour, and more standard machines (mechanical systems are back; less electronics) for SMEs and developing markets. The Packaging industry also takes action for environmental protection via its expenses, i.e. € 41.7 million in 2006, essentially devoted to investments downstream from the production process.
